Transaction 5c9413447db98be67aed2f2330294555bada631ae1bcb910e41ad6972cab65b5
1 Input
1 Output
-
5c9413447db98be67aed2f2330294555bada631ae1bcb910e41ad6972cab65b5:0
- value
- 3038946
- script pubkey
- OP_0 OP_PUSHBYTES_20 248e6d4a978e5a92a66098d6b75357009ad768c6
- address
- bc1qyj8x6j5h3edf9fnqnrttw56hqzddw6xxr44cyq